|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Alexander Kolesnikoff 2:5020/400 24 Jan 2002 05:46:24 To : "Alexander V. Ribchansky" Subject : Re: RADIUS + [ hardware NAS | software NAS] -------------------------------------------------------------------------------- Alexander V. Ribchansky <triosoft@triosoft.com.ua> wrote: > > > Господа! > > Cпасибо тем, кто уже в эху и мылом ответил! > С Session-timaout приблизительно понял мысль, но вот тут вопрос: > если я правильно понимаю/помню (я вроде как читал RFC :o) > Session-timeout единежды (???) после успешной авторизации выдается, а > вот как быть, если тарифный план поменялся во время работы (ну скажем > "дневной инет" сменился на "ночной инет" более дешевый) и соответственно > время работы надо бы продлить? И возможно ли написать некого демона (или > приблуду к радиусу) которая бы динамически отслеживала тарифный план и > вносила соответствующие данные аккаунтинга (получаемого от РАДИУСА) в > базу данных? > > Господа, я знаю о существовании готовых систем биллинга, где все это > есть, но сами знаете сколько они стоят... посему и затевается разработка > чего-то своего... При этом я не прошу все за меня сделать, а лишь > пытаюсь разобраться в какую сторону "копать".. > Кому как, а мне система с отслеживанием в реальном времени активности клиентов и связанного с этим вычисления остатка денег на счету, сбрасыванием линии, если баланс = 0, не нравится в принципе. Моё решение: вычислять значение аттрибута Session-Timeout один раз, при входе клиента в систему, с учётом смены тарифных планов во время сеанса связи. Вычислять остаток на счету клиента один раз, по окончанию сеанса связи. Всё это должен делать радиус. Какие будут мнения ? Alexander --- ifmail v.2.15dev5 * Origin: UKU (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/7525eaa70e02.html, оценка из 5, голосов 10
|